Name: Realms of Quest II: Anniversary Edition
Author: Ghislain
Released: August 2, 2011.
Requirements: Unexpanded VIC-20 + Disk Drive
Description: This month marks the 20th anniversary of Realms of Quest. It was in the Summer of 1991 that I embarked on making a computer role playing game for the Commodore VIC-20. I was successful in completing the first one, but I had given up in creating a sequel shortly afterwards. I did create about 20 monster portrait graphics pixel by pixel with a simple graphics program, however. In 2004, I programmed a "mini" version of Realms of Quest II intended for the Minigame Competition; minus the portrait graphics, because to use them would surpass the 4K limit that the competition required.

So twenty years after I had made the original Realms of Quest I, I decided to revamp the first two games. And so I took the portrait graphics I had made in 1992-93 and combined them with the Minigame version of Realms of Quest II. So finally after all these years, there is a fuller and more complete version of the middle of this CRPG series.

Instructions on how to play can be read from the main game menu.

Name: The Last VIC
Author: Orion70
Released (final): October 21, 2011
Requirements: VIC-20 + 8K RAM
Description: VIC version of R. Adling's Earth Defender game for C16. It makes use of hi-res 160x192 graphics handled via Mike's Minigrafik extension (and bootloader creation utility). Play the role of the last defender in your home planet, aiming at hostile alien bombs. With your Commodore VIC-20's expansion port (!), you control an adjustable cannon. You must hit 19 bombs each level (12 in the colour version), but they keep coming faster and faster... Don't let the aliens destroy your city, and beware of limited time!

Name: Theater of War II: The Pacific
Author: Ghislain
Released: November 5, 2011
Requirements: Unexpanded VIC-20 + Disk Drive.
Description: In the sequel to the first WW2 Tactical Strategy game that takes place on the Eastern Front in Russia, this time you are transported to the Pacific Ocean where you command the Imperial Japanese Navy against the American forces.

The preamble states: "June 1942. Our Grand Imperial Navy is chasing the Yankee interlopers across the Pacific Ocean. We will attack a fatal blow at Midway and then hunt them into their havens". If you can defeat the the enemy through five levels of increasing difficulty, you will have achieved the ultimate victory.

There is also a two-player option. Instructions are included in the game program from the main menu.

Name: Theater of War III: Western Front 1918
Author: Ghislain
Released: November 26, 2011
Requirements: Unexpanded VIC-20 + Disk Drive.
Description: The tactical wargaming series for the VIC-20 now takes place in the trenches of World War I.

March 1918. Russia, in the midst of revolution and civil war has surrendered in the East. Now is the chance to break the stalemate on the Western Front. As a commander of the German Empire's army, your task will be to take on the French forces as you advance to the Marne river, and then onwards to Paris. Be aware, however, that with each successful victory, the Allied resources of the British and the Americans will be increasingly used against you.

Includes a two-player option. Instructions are included in the game program from the main menu and a PDF manual is included with the download.
